Meaning of "debt clock"

A debt clock is a visual representation or display that shows the current amount of outstanding debt (usually government debt) in a particular country or region. It often includes the total debt figure, as well as the per capita debt, and may update in real-time to reflect changes in the debt balance. Debt clocks are commonly used to raise awareness about growing debt burdens
